Output 6e88f95302cae977d1dab3d8636b61cf88f8ac457a0d91f96e91143bdea0c86f:14

value
6434561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fb31b09ac81d28484dfafb554899c7d9ccbd8bb OP_EQUALVERIFY OP_CHECKSIG
address
12S1hMXLskbwXz9kecZWmq2HXdNE6Dy6FZ
transaction
6e88f95302cae977d1dab3d8636b61cf88f8ac457a0d91f96e91143bdea0c86f
confirmations
166692
spent
true